Boxing: One of the oldest and most revered fighting styles, boxing provides a solid foundation of competitive skills. Proper footwork, mobility, technique and mindset are developed throughout this course, offering competitive applications as well as an excellent exercise program for those not interested in competition.
Kickboxing: This module teaches the fundamentals of Muay Thai style kickboxing, both for exercise and competition. Integrating punches, kicks, knee and elbow strikes, this is a devastating and complex style of fighting, and it can offer a great workout as well as competitive ability.
Grappling: Combining Judo,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u, wrestling and “catch” wrestling, this module teaches the submission holds, positions and maneuvers necessary to become a competitive grappler and provides an outstanding workout: building endurance, body strength, agility and flexibility.
Mixed Martial Arts: Made famous by the “Ultimate Fighting Championships®” among other similar styled events, Mixed Martial Arts is in many ways the evolution of modern competitive martial arts. This module integrates the skills of Grappling, Boxing and Kickboxing into a devastating blend of styles allowing for a full range of competitive skill sets, as well as an unparalleled workout.
